Mild Development Spending Rises

8 May 2009

devspendMild improvements in development spending has been noted in the US which may signal a slight improvement in the overall commercial real estate business. Many development projects have been put on hold as the economy slid into recession with millions losing their jobs in the construction industry. The effects of the economy has reached far beyond the borders of the US with the world slipping into recession as the markets tumbled affecting most global industries.
Good news like the mild increase in housing sales last February are very much welcome, even if they last only a very short time. Life has indeed become a bit harder as the world tries to pick up itself from the economic crunch that has gripped the world. Coupled with the ill effects of the developing “swine flu pandemic”, more economic troubles are seen ahead. With it spreading like wildfire, it stands to worsen the already bad economic standing of most countries who have been clamoring to recover by pushing cash out of their government coffers to help boost their respective economies.
